Puducherry, April 5 (IANS) Thol Thirumavalavan, president of the Viduthalai Chiruthaigal Katchi (VCK), on Sunday announced that the party will contest only the Uzhavarkarai Assembly constituency in Puducherry, following seat-sharing discussions with alliance partners. He said the decision was finalised after talks held in Puducherry with senior leaders of the Indian National Congress, including Mukul Wasnik, as part of efforts to streamline the alliance’s electoral strategy.As per the agreemen…

Chennai, March 24 (IANS) In a key step towards consolidating its electoral alliance, the DMK on Tuesday sealed a seat-sharing deal with the VCK, allotting eight Assembly constituencies to the Dalit-focused party ahead of the upcoming Tamil Nadu polls.The agreement, finalised after multiple rounds of negotiations, provides the VCK with six reserved constituencies and two general constituencies.The pact was formally signed at the DMK headquarters, Anna Arivalayam, in the presence of Chief Minister…

Chennai, March 2 (IANS) With the announcement of the Tamil Nadu Assembly elections expected shortly, alliance negotiations have gathered pace across the political spectrum. The ruling DMK on Monday commenced formal seat-sharing discussions with its key ally, the Viduthalai Chiruthaigal Katchi (VCK), at the DMK’s headquarters in Chennai. The meeting was attended by senior leaders from both parties. VCK President Thol. Thirumavalavan and General Secretary Ravikumar represented the party in the dis…
